SQL数据库备份:服务器数据安全指南
sql备份服务器数据库

首页 2025-04-15 14:50:35



SQL备份服务器数据库:确保数据安全的关键策略 在当今这个数字化时代,数据已成为企业最宝贵的资产之一

    无论是金融交易记录、客户信息、业务运营数据,还是知识产权和创新成果,数据都是驱动企业决策、维持竞争优势和提供卓越客户体验的核心

    然而,数据面临的威胁无处不在——从自然灾害到人为错误,再到恶意攻击,任何一次数据丢失或损坏都可能对企业的运营造成不可估量的损失

    因此,实施有效的SQL备份服务器数据库策略,不仅是数据保护的基本要求,更是企业持续稳健发展的基石

     一、为什么备份SQL服务器数据库至关重要? 1.灾难恢复:自然灾害(如地震、洪水)或硬件故障可能导致整个数据中心瘫痪

    没有可靠的备份,企业可能面临数据永久丢失的风险

    而及时的数据库备份能确保在灾难发生后迅速恢复业务运营,减少停机时间和经济损失

     2.防止数据丢失:人为错误(如误删除关键数据)或软件故障同样可能导致数据损坏或丢失

    定期备份能提供一个“时光机”,允许用户回滚到错误发生前的状态,保护数据的完整性和准确性

     3.合规性要求:许多行业和地区都有严格的数据保护和隐私法规,要求企业保留特定时间段内的数据记录

    备份不仅有助于满足这些合规要求,还能在必要时提供审计证据

     4.业务连续性:在竞争激烈的市场环境中,业务中断意味着客户流失、收入减少和品牌信誉受损

    有效的备份和恢复策略能够缩短恢复时间目标(RTO)和恢复点目标(RPO),确保业务在遭遇不测时能够快速恢复,维持服务的连续性和可用性

     二、SQL备份的基本原则与方法 1.定期备份:根据数据的变动频率和业务需求,制定合理的备份计划

    对于高频变化的数据,应实施更频繁的备份策略,如每日甚至每小时备份

    同时,定期执行全量备份和增量/差异备份,以平衡备份效率和存储空间需求

     2.异地备份:将备份数据存储在与主数据中心物理分离的位置,可以有效抵御本地灾难的影响

    这可以通过云存储服务、远程数据中心或磁带库等方式实现,确保在极端情况下仍有数据副本可用

     3.自动化与监控:利用SQL Server Management Studio(SSMS)、第三方备份软件或脚本自动化备份过程,减少人为错误并提高效率

    同时,实施监控机制,确保每次备份成功完成,并及时通知管理员任何异常情况

     4.加密与安全性:备份数据同样需要保护,防止未经授权的访问

    采用加密技术存储备份文件,限制访问权限,并定期审查和更新安全策略,确保备份数据的安全

     5.测试恢复流程:定期进行恢复演练,验证备份数据的可用性和恢复流程的有效性

    这不仅能帮助发现潜在问题,还能提升团队在真实灾难发生时的应对能力

     三、SQL Server备份的具体实施步骤 1.规划备份策略:根据业务需求确定备份类型(全量、增量、差异)、频率、保留周期和存储位置

    考虑使用SQL Server内置的备份工具或第三方解决方案

     2.配置备份作业:在SSMS中,使用“维护计划向导”或T-SQL脚本创建备份作业

    指定备份类型、目标位置(如本地磁盘、网络共享或云存储)以及备份文件的命名规则

     3.自动化备份任务:利用SQL Server Agent服务,将备份作业安排为定时任务

    确保SQL Server Agent服务正常运行,并配置适当的通知机制,以便在备份失败时及时获得通知

     4.验证备份完整性:每次备份后,使用`RESTORE VERIFYONLY`命令检查备份文件的完整性,确保备份数据没有损坏

     5.实施异地备份:配置SQL Server的日志传送、镜像或复制功能,或将备份文件复制到远程位置

    考虑使用Azure Blob存储等云解决方案,实现成本效益和灵活性的平衡

     6.监控与报告:利用SSMS的报告功能或第三方监控工具,定期审查备份作业的状态、成功率和存储空间使用情况

    生成报告,以便管理层了解备份策略的执行情况和改进空间

     四、面对挑战,持续优化备份策略 随着企业业务的增长和数据量的增加,备份策略也需要不断调整和优化

    以下是一些应对挑战的建议: - 采用先进的备份技术:如云备份、快照技术和数据去重,以提高备份效率和降低成本

     - 实施分级存储策略:根据数据的访问频率和重要性,将数据备份到不同层级的存储介质上,平衡性能和成本

     - 增强数据恢复能力:探索即时恢复、数据库克隆等高级功能,缩短恢复时间,提升业务连续性

     - 培训与教育:定期对IT团队进行数据备份和恢复流程的培训,提高团队的整体应急响应能力

     五、结语 SQL备份服务器数据库是企业数据保护战略的核心组成部分,直接关系到业务的连续性和数据的安全性

    通过实施定期、自动化、安全且可测试的备份策略,结合先进的备份技术和持续的策略优化,企业能够有效抵御数据丢失的风险,确保在任何情况下都能迅速恢复业务运营

    在这个数据驱动的时代,保护好数据,就是保护好企业的未来

    让我们携手共进,为数据的安全保驾护航!

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道